EPA v. Columbia Care, LLC

Final Order With Specified Cost Recovery

Case summary

On November 13, 2020, EPA Region 2 signed Administrative Settlement Agreement and Order on Consent, under which the Respondent, will perform certain removal activities at the Cidra Contaminated Groundwater Area Superfund Site located in Cidra, Puerto Rico. While installing a handicap ramp in December 2018 at property that is part of the Site, Respondent damaged an EPA monitoring well, rendering it unusable. EPA will oversee Respondent's work under the Agreement and Respondent will reimburse EPA for up to $118,000 in response costs, including oversight costs, associated with the damaged well.
